If you’re a Telemetry Registered Nurse curious about Travel job trends in Newport News, VA, AMN Healthcare has successfully filled 15 similar positions in the area, providing insight into the opportunities you could expect. These previously filled roles offered competitive pay, with an average weekly rate of $1,999 and a range from $1,506 to $2,184 per week, showcasing the strong earning potential for professionals in this field.
Positions were located in key zip codes, including 23602 and 23601. These placements reflect the high demand for skilled Telemetry Registered Nurses in Newport News’s thriving healthcare landscape. As a Telemetry Registered Nurse in Newport News, Virginia, you can expect to work in a variety of healthcare settings that are equipped to monitor and manage patients with cardiovascular issues. Facilities such as the Riverside Health System and Sentara Healthcare offer dynamic environments where you will utilize cutting-edge telemetry technology to assess patient vital signs, interpret cardiac rhythms, and respond to urgent situations in fast-paced medical and surgical units. Your role may involve collaboration with interdisciplinary teams, educating patients and their families about heart health and recovery, and participating in care planning to ensure optimal patient outcomes. Whether in a bustling hospital setting or a specialized cardiac care unit, you will play a crucial role in delivering high-quality care to patients in need of continuous monitoring and support.

Telemetry Registered Nurse travel jobs in Newport News, Virginia typically require a valid nursing license and experience in telemetry nursing, ideally with familiarity in cardiac monitoring and critical care environments. Preferred qualifications often include certifications such as ACLS and BLS, along with experience in high-acuity settings to ensure effective patient care and safety.
Telemetry Registered Nurse travel jobs in Newport News, Virginia, are typically found in acute care hospitals and specialized cardiac care centers. These facilities often require skilled nurses to monitor and manage patients with cardiac conditions.
For Telemetry RN Travel jobs in Newport News, VA, typical contract durations range from 9-12 weeks, 13 weeks, and 14-26 weeks. These flexible contract lengths allow you to choose an assignment that best fits your career goals and lifestyle preferences.
